标签: angularjs html5
有没有办法,如果我有一个HTML 5' required'输入属性,如果由于ng-show没有触发输入而未显示该输入,则不会触发所需的'属性?
答案 0 :(得分:1)
您可以使用ngRequired指令。
虽然如果有人填写了该字段,然后以隐藏的方式更改了表单,则仍会发送该值。使用ngDisabled可以解决这个问题。您当然可以将ng-show / ng-hide与此结合使用。
ng-show
ng-hide
演示:http://plnkr.co/edit/NWUiXWQO8oZQVZesblFq?p=preview